There are 2,280.94 miles from Arcadia to Ronald Reagan Washington National Airport (DCA) in east direction and 2,655 miles (4,272.81 kilometers) by car, following the I-40 route.

Arcadia and DCA Airport are 1 day 22 hours far apart, if you drive non-stop .

This is the fastest route from Arcadia, CA to DCA Airport. The halfway point is Jones, OK.
